Which is better: BA Hons. Journalism from Lady Shri Ram or Delhi College of Arts and Commerce?

AC
Aritra Chowdhury Posted On : November 26th, 2021
B.A Honours in History & Ancient Indian History, Culture & Archaeology, University of Delhi (2019)

B.A Hons. in Journalism from Lady Shri Ram College is definitely a better option than DCAC. It is way better in terms of campus, ranking, reputation, student crowd, etc. The cutoff required for the institute is also higher. So, you will be among competitive peers. If you don’t get LSR, try to get into other south-campus colleges. DCAC is not included in any of the DU campuses, which is a huge disadvantage.

How expensive is it to get a management quota seat in Maharaja Agrasen Institute of Management Studies in Delhi for a BJMC with a CET rank of 2,226?

AC
Ankit Chaturvedi Posted On : August 26th, 2022
Lived in New Delhi

The estimated fees for management quota seats in Maharaja Agrasen Institute of Management Studies in Delhi for a BJMC are around INR 10-12 Lakhs. Note that this is just an estimate, not the specific amount that is required. The required fees vary each year depending on the competition and other factors.

How is Devi Ahilya Vishwavidyalaya for a BA in journalism and mass communication?

AM
Amrita Mehra, Posted On : November 23rd, 2021
studied at Devi Ahilya Vishwavidyalaya, Indore (2019)

Devi Ahilya Vishwavidyalaya (DAVV) is considered to be one of the best colleges for Journalism and Mass Communication in Indore and its surrounding areas. It is also the 2nd best journalism college in Madhya Pradesh.

If you are from Indore thenDAVV will be the best choice. If you are from Bhopal, then go for Makhanlal Chaturvedi University (MCU) Bhopal. 

Do not go to private colleges to pursue Mass Comm. as most of them have a huge course fee. Students of these colleges often claim to have irregular classes. 

Therefore, the best colleges for Mass Comm you can go for are:

  • Makhanlal Chaturvedi University (MCU) Bhopal.
  • Devi Ahilya Vishwavidyalaya (DAVV) Indore.

If you do not get selected in any of these colleges, you can then go for People’s College Bhopal or IPS Indore.

How is the BA (J&MC) course at Amity Gwalior?

AJ
Ankush Jain Posted On : May 4th, 2021
Studied at Amity University Gwalior (2019)

Amity School of Communication (ASCO) under the Amity University Gwalior is a media education institute in the state of Madhya Pradesh giving a Bachelor’s as well as Master’s degree in Journalism and Mass Media. It produces many print and electronics journalists, advertising professionals, public relations professionals, photojournalists, and academicians in the field. 

The details of the course are discussed below –

  • Course Structure – It is a 3-year course spread across 6 semesters. It is a very good blend of traditional value systems and ethics along with modern practical and theoretical knowledge in sync with the industry demands.
  • Facilities – The school has a multi-storied studio with cutting-edge acoustics and audio-visual settings equipped with all important musical instruments, a modern photography lab, print, advertising, and digital as well as an editing lab. It also has a VFX-Chroma-enabled newsroom with a voice room and dedicated MCR to get a practical exposure to the real-life working of studios. 
  • Career Options – Media consumption has only increased over the years and will continue to grow as well in the foreseeable future. With the rapid growth of online advertising, newspapers and news agencies will offer careers as actors, editors, VJ, RJ, screenwriters, producers, etc.

Overall, a career in Journalism and Mass Communication is very lucrative with ample opportunities given that you have passion for the field and you are willing to work in the space.

Is Amity Gwalior good for journalism?

VK
Vijay Kaushal Posted On : June 11th, 2021
Studied at NIFT Kolkata (2019)

Amity University located in Gwalior, Madhya Pradesh is considered the top private university in Madhya Pradesh. One of my cousins is pursuing a BA in Journalism. So, let me share his experiences, which might help you answer the question.

About the course:

  • They offer a 3 years course with six semesters.
  • You will learn eleven subjects per semester.
  • It provides students with both theoretical and practical knowledge.

Facilities:

  • They have the latest equipment for print, electronic, and new media.
  • You get a VFX-Chrome-designed newsroom with MCR, voice-room, updated software, radio-room where students broadcast their radio show on online radio “am radio”, Macintosh, etc.
  • Students also get experience with musical instruments in its art audio-visual studio.
  • They also have a photography lab, printing room, advertising room, digital lab, and more.

Course Fee

3.18 lakh

Placement Percentage

100%

Highest CTC

4.5 - 7 LPA

Average CTC

2.4 LPA

Top Recruiters

Times of India, Aaj Tak, Star TV, My FM, Jost Talks, Prime Focus, Wittyfeed, Zee News, Tehelka, Dainik Jagran.

Therefore, Amity University’s Gwalior is good for pursuing journalism. The communication department provides good opportunities to students by giving them practical and theoretical knowledge, and by offering good placement.

How difficult is to take admission in BJMC at IMS Ghaziabad?

AR
Aditi Roy Posted On : June 19th, 2023
lives in Gwalior, Madhya Pradesh, India

Admission difficulty in BJMC at IMS Ghaziabad depends on several factors such as the number of applicants, the availability of seats, and the level of competition. However, here is some general information about the admission process for BJMC at IMS Ghaziabad:

  1. Eligibility criteria: To be eligible for admission to BJMC at IMS Ghaziabad, a candidate must have passed a 10+2 or equivalent examination from a recognized board with a minimum of 50% marks.
  2. Admission process: The admission process for BJMC at IMS Ghaziabad typically involves an entrance test, followed by a group discussion and personal interview. The entrance test is designed to assess your knowledge of the English language, general awareness, communication skills, and personality.
  3. Entrance test: The entrance test for BJMC at IMS Ghaziabad is conducted online and comprises objective-type questions. The duration of the test is 90 minutes and covers topics such as current affairs, media aptitude, and general knowledge.
  4. Cut-off: IMS Ghaziabad releases a cut-off list based on the scores obtained in the entrance test, and only those candidates who meet the cut-off criteria are called for group discussion and personal interviews.
